In 2026 employers will be able to provide up to $340 a month in tax-free (to employee) parking benefits, transit, or vanpool, but nothing for people who walk or ride a bike to work.

Maybe we should throw this benefit out the window and encourage taxable general cash benefits for transportation.

The Blattner family's Isangi REDD project sold 1.3 million carbon credits.

@hannanik.bsky.social and Jonas Gerding analysed the satellite images of the project and concluded that it led to few, if any, emissions reductions.

reddmonitor.substack.com/p/isangi-red...
Isangi REDD project: “Emissions reductions were likely short-lived if they occurred at all”
Verra has frozen the buffer pool carbon credits from the project.
